Navigating the Digital Age: Digital Eye Strain


In today's digital era, our reliance on screens has skyrocketed, be it for work, entertainment, or staying connected. While this technological revolution has brought unparalleled convenience, it has also given rise to a common concern: Digital Eye Strain (DES).

Understanding Digital Eye Strain (DES)

Digital Eye Strain, often referred to as computer vision syndrome, is a condition that arises from prolonged use of digital devices such as computers, smartphones, and tablets. The symptoms are diverse and can include:

  1. Eye Discomfort: Dry eyes, itching, burning sensations.
  2. Blurred Vision: Difficulty focusing on the screen.
  3. Headaches: Persistent headaches, especially after extended screen time.
  4. Neck and Shoulder Pain: Strained posture leading to discomfort.
  5. Sleep Disturbances: Prolonged screen exposure can disrupt sleep patterns.

Causes of Digital Eye Strain

  1. Screen Glare and Reflections: Poor lighting conditions and glare on screens contribute to eye strain.
  2. Blue Light Exposure: Digital screens emit blue light, which can disrupt circadian rhythms and contribute to eye strain.
  3. Poor Ergonomics: Incorrect screen height, chair position, and keyboard placement can lead to discomfort.

Protective Measures for Your Eyes

  1. Follow the 20-20-20 Rule: Every 20 minutes, look at something 20 feet away for at least 20 seconds to reduce eye strain.
  2. Adjust Screen Settings: Dim the screen brightness and adjust the contrast to a comfortable level.
  3. Use Blue Light Filters: Consider applying blue light filters on your devices or invest in blue light-blocking glasses.
  4. Proper Lighting: Ensure ambient lighting is adequate and avoid glare on screens.
  5. Optimize Workspace Ergonomics: Position your screen at eye level, maintain proper chair and desk height, and use an ergonomic chair.

Regular Eye Exams

Schedule regular eye examinations to monitor and address any changes in your vision. An eye care professional can provide guidance on specialized eyewear or lens coatings to alleviate digital eye strain.

Digital Detox

Consider incorporating digital detox periods into your routine. Disconnecting from screens for short breaks can significantly reduce eye strain and enhance overall well-being.
